Dear Shipmates

Introduction

"Life is like sailing. You can use any wind to go any direction" Robert Brault.

My wife and I would love to join on your amazing life and adventures. Always been interested in sailing but never really known how to get involved. Not all that many sailing vessels in the mountainous area of Canada, ha ha.

A little about myself, my interests and my plans

clean & tidycommittedeasy-goingenthusiasticfit & healthyfriendlyorganisedrespectfulskilledtrustworthyconfident swimmerrarely/unlikely seasickgood listenergood communicatorno body piercingsno facial piercingsno tattoos at allvisible tattoostravel light (little luggage)eager to learn & workpoliteLGBTIQA+ respectfulperfectionistpositive outlookopen mindedsense of humorcan pay own expensesenjoy cookingdon't mind cleaninggood with maintenancecan follow orderslive on little moneylearn a languagewish to bring a friend

I am a highly adventurous person, I love getting out, getting involved and taking the most out of every situation. I am regularly seen out hiking and backpacking in the mountain, mountain biking, kayaking, rock climbing, SCUBA diving and getting into what ever else I can. I have spent most of my adult live travelling and exploring the world. I truly enjoy meeting new people and experiencing the adventures of their life. The desire to learn new things is a driving force for my future. I am an electrician by trade but I have recently returned to post secondary school for electrical engineering technology. I do come as part of a team with my Wife. She is a lot like me and we complement each other very well, I am just a little funnier! We also have the addition of a set of twin girls born in the middle of June 2018. I understand these two little anchors can cause a bit of hesitation for some but Shannon and I are both excited to get the kids involved with everything there is to see. They have already sailed from the Whitsunday Islands to Carins, Australia, travelled through South East Asia around the Middle East and even hiked to Mount Everest Base camp in Nepal. They come with us everywhere and are keen on it as well.
